16 oz. Can
Poured into a Trillium glass a pretty nice cloudy pinkish color, pretty nice carbonation, with a pretty nice thick/cream/foamy/fizz one-finger plus off-white head, which also leaves some sticky lacing behind. The nose is hoppy, malty, with a nice citrus complex (orange, tangerine, grapefruit, mango, peach), hibiscus, little diesel like. The taste is pretty nice, hoppy, malty, with a pretty nice citrus complex (orange, tangerine, grapefruit, mango, peach), hibiscus, nice diesel like. Medium body, ABV hidden pretty nicely, with a nice little dry/bitter finish. Overall, a pretty tasty brew. Glad to have gotten a chance to try it. Thanks John!

I picked a can of this up when I visited the brewery sometime ago. It poured a murky amber with thin white head that is not leaving much lace. The scent had faint dank dark fruit. The taste was nicely balanced and easy to drink with dark plum presence. The mouthfeel was Lighter in body with good carbonation .overall it was a decent beer.

Poured from a can into a snifter. Very unique looking beer. Extremely hazy in the NEIPA style but with a nice pink tinge out of the can - a hazy peach color with a frothy pinkish white head. Great lacing in the glass. Very floral on the nose with prominent hibiscus, peach, mango, and orange. The taste followed closely - tons of floral notes with bright citrus and balanced with a subtle herbal presence. Bready malt and a soft feel. Well done.
